Output de5223f57a193275cf4cd3a8c791e15c3b25b9b9110291c658fd4db57000e0a6:1

value
250000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b629106b15d93ccc9725cd19eb19b79c5bfd75b5 OP_EQUAL
address
3JJC6eF6uj3W14uSVZ5PJY3oVp2iXZWtHy
transaction
de5223f57a193275cf4cd3a8c791e15c3b25b9b9110291c658fd4db57000e0a6
confirmations
166139
spent
true